Speed and mobility are the essence of modern warfare. Traditional concrete towers are static targets and take months to build. In contrast, the military sector of the Remote Towers Market offers agility. Defense forces can now deploy air traffic services anywhere in hours. This capability is changing how airbases are managed in conflict zones and humanitarian missions.
Introduction
Imagine a temporary airfield in a disaster zone. There is no infrastructure. A military transport plane lands, deploying a mobile remote tower unit. Within hours, a fully functional control center is running. This scenario is the core strength of military remote towers. They provide "eyes on the ground" without exposing personnel to direct danger. Controllers can sit safely in a bunker miles away while managing the airfield.
Market Growth Factors and Drivers
Force protection is the biggest driver. Keeping personnel out of harm's way is a priority. Remote towers allow controllers to operate from fortified locations. This reduces the risk of casualties during attacks on airfields.
Additionally, budget efficiency matters to defense departments. Maintaining multiple physical towers at training bases is costly. Centralizing control saves money and manpower. The remote towers market also benefits from the need for rapid deployability. Mobile systems mounted on trucks or containers are in high demand for expeditionary forces.
Segmentation Analysis
The military market segments by mobility and function.
- Fixed Remote Towers: Used at permanent domestic bases to reduce costs.
- Mobile/Tactical Systems: Containerized units that can be airlifted. These include telescoping masts with cameras.
- Ship-based Systems: Aircraft carriers are exploring remote tech to enhance deck management.
Regional Analysis
The United States leads in military adoption. The US Air Force and Marines are actively testing mobile systems. They need solutions that work in diverse environments, from deserts to the Arctic.
Europe is also a key player. NATO nations are standardizing equipment to ensure interoperability. If a German unit deploys a remote tower, a British pilot should be able to rely on it. This collaboration drives the remote towers market across the continent. In the Asia-Pacific, rising geopolitical tensions drive investment in resilient airbase infrastructure.
Future Growth
The future will see "unmanned airbases." Drones could land, refuel, and take off automatically, monitored by a distant center. AI will help identify friend or foe aircraft instantly. We will also see greater integration with battlefield management systems. The remote tower will become a node in a larger digital combat network.
Frequently Asked Questions
- Can mobile remote towers be jammed?
They use advanced anti-jamming technology. Directional antennas and frequency hopping secure the link against electronic warfare.
- How fast can a mobile tower be set up?
Some tactical systems can be operational in under 4 hours. This is crucial for emergency response or rapid advances.
- Do they work in total darkness?
Yes. Infrared and night-vision sensors provide excellent visibility. They often see better than a soldier with binoculars at night.
